The odd ramblings of a geek pretending to not be "all grown up"

STEM Evangelism, here I come

A couple of months ago, I joined a new team in Microsoft, one focused on something I hold near and...

Date: 06/13/2016

Creating Great Apps

Note: This is a summary of a guide that I and a couple of other great people worked on – link to the...

Date: 07/31/2013

Quick Coaching Session for Imagine Cup Games

As the deadline is fast approaching for the online Imagine Cup Games competition, we thought it...

Date: 03/25/2013

WOWZAPP 2012: Want to get involved?

I’m truly excited about WOWZAPP 2012: Worldwide Hackathon for Windows, and it’s great to see all...

Date: 10/15/2012

  With the general availability of Windows 8 rapidly approaching (October 26, if you missed the...

Date: 09/11/2012

Courses for Windows 8

If you’re teaching development in a school or college and want to bring your content up to date with...

Date: 08/09/2012

Game Design Winners Announced!

The World Festival of Imagine Cup 2012 is on right now in Sydney, Australia and I'm ecstatic to...

Date: 07/10/2012

Final Six for Software Design Announced

Just minutes ago the top six teams were announced for the Software Design competition of Imagine Cup...

Date: 07/08/2012

Top Ten for Game Design

Congratulations to the top five teams in the two Game Design tracks for progressing to the final...

Date: 07/07/2012

Top Twenty Software Design Finalist Teams

Just moments ago we announced the top twenty teams at the Imagine Cup worldwide finals in Sydney,...

Date: 07/07/2012

Imagine Cup 2012 Game Design Finalists – Xbox/Windows

Here we are again! Another year and another brilliant batch of games that have wowed the judges....

Date: 05/23/2012

GlobalGameJam – It’s On, We’re There!

I’m totally excited for this weekend. It’s the annual GlobalGameJam where hundreds of...

Date: 01/26/2012

Just One More Week To Enter The Rock Paper Azure Fall Sweepstakes!

Normally I like to write my own text for my blog posts, but my team mate, Peter Laudati, has done a...

Date: 12/10/2011

Cool Apps – Parcel Tracker

I am constantly discovering super cool apps for the Windows Phone and a team mate suggested I should...

Date: 12/06/2011

Game Design Scoring Rubric 2012

One question that crops up a lot when I talk to students about the Game Design competitions is how...

Date: 12/06/2011

Where to start… Windows Phone applications

In a recent post, I walked through the process of getting up and running with DreamSpark, AppHub,...

Date: 11/14/2011

Where is MrAndyPuppy this week?

I truly love my job. It takes me to exotic places like Cairo, Warsaw and Paris. It gets my...

Date: 11/10/2011

Winter XNA Games – Learn, Compete, Have Fun!

We’re holding another game camp, this time a mega-one! We have four different activities to choose...

Date: 10/31/2011

Game Design Office Hours

To make it easier to ask questions about Imagine Cup and Game Design, I’ve set up a series of...

Date: 10/28/2011

New York Code Camp – Register before it’s too late

The sixth New York City Code Camp is just around the corner – have you registered yet? It’s going to...

Date: 09/14/2011

Phone Camps are GO!

A Phone Camp is an all day event where you get to go hands on with Windows Phone 7.0 and 7.5,...

Date: 09/14/2011

100 Students, 22 Schools – Now THAT’S a Game Camp!

WOOHOO! The third game camp for New York is at a close and it finished off an amazing February with...

Date: 03/13/2011

Want to learn how to build your own games for Xbox or Phone?

If you do – I strongly encourage you to keep an eye out for game camps in your area or even better...

Date: 02/25/2011

HTML5 Inspiration

If you’re keen to try your hand at HTML5 for the web track of Game Design in Imagine Cup this year...

Date: 02/19/2011

Imagine Cup Live Meeting recordings

Just a heads up that the two live meetings we held last week to field questions and cover...

Date: 02/17/2011

We <3 Games – Flickr Set

I’ve uploaded a few photos from the We <3 Games weekend at Rochester Institute of Technology to...

Date: 02/13/2011
